Whether Taylor Swift is "secretly awesome" is entirely subjective and depends on your perspective and criteria for "awesomeness." However, I can offer some facts and insights that might help you form your own opinion:
Arguments for her being awesome:
- Talented songwriter and musician: Swift writes her own songs, plays multiple instruments, and has garnered critical acclaim for her lyrics and musicality.
- Commercial success: She's one of the best-selling music artists of all time, with numerous awards and accolades under her belt.
- Business savvy: She's known for her strategic moves in the music industry, owning her master recordings and re-recording her first six albums.
- Philanthropy and activism: She's actively involved in charitable causes and uses her platform to speak out on social issues like LGBTQ+ rights and voter education.
- Strong work ethic and determination: She's known for her dedication and resilience, overcoming challenges and constantly evolving as an artist.
- Connection with fans: She fosters a strong relationship with her fanbase, known as "Swifties," through her music, social media, and personal interactions.
Some possible critiques:
- Public image and media scrutiny: Some find her carefully curated image and frequent media presence disingenuous.
- Musical evolution: Some fans prefer her earlier country music and feel her pop transition diluted her artistry.
- Personal relationships and lyrics: Some find her songs overly focused on heartbreak and past relationships.
Ultimately, whether you find Taylor Swift awesome is a matter of personal taste and opinion. However, it's undeniable that she's a talented artist, successful businesswoman, and influential figure with a dedicated fanbase and a multifaceted personality.
